Heisenberg Special Strain Information
A limited-edition weed, Heisenberg Special, is an autoflowering indica and Sativa strain by Mephisto Genetics. Created in the hot summer of 2015, the strain is a combination of Walter White and 24 Carat. It produces dense buds with excellent trichomes, emitting a sour pepper smell. It can be grown indoors, outdoors, and in a greenhouse.
What are the Flavor and Effects of Heisenberg Special?
The special strain’s sour lemon and pepper and aroma are also the same as its taste. The euphoric high hits smoothly, but still powerful. It targets more of the psychoactive side while providing a calming body high at the same time. Attention span and focus are increased, thus increasing productivity as well. The user will be in such a carefree state and will find himself being more industrious and giggly all day. It is a perfect strain to smoke at any time of the day.

Negative Effects you Can Expect from Heisenberg Special
As common with other powerful strains, Heisenberg Special induces parched throat, cottonmouth, and dry eyes. If consumed carelessly, the user will experience drowsiness, paranoia, nausea, and anxiety. The solution is as easy as drinking water, and simply controlling intake.
How to grow Heisenberg Special?
The special strain is suitable for either Sea of Green (SOG) or Screen of Green (SCROG) growing. It also thrives well in Low Stress Training (LST). It can also grow bushy, so the topping will help in maintaining its sturdy structure, as well as avoiding molds. Leaf tucking is highly recommended.
